2008: Started in all 17 games she played ... Named First Team All-Conference as a sophomore ... Named to the Big Sky All-Academic Team ... Led the Bengals on the backline ... Broke through the backline for one shot attempt in the season against Brigham Young (9/13). 2007: Started in 13 of the 17 games she played ... Netted two goals from six attempts during the season ... Scored a header off the corner kick for a game tying goal against Gonzaga (9/28) in the 84th minute for her first goal as a Bengal ... Henage scored the opening goal against Southern Utah (10/6) in the 10th minute of the game. High School: A four-year starter for Springville High School ... Ranks tied for first on the SHS all-time career mark for game-winning goals with nine ... Also ranks second at SHS in career goals (26) and fourth in assists (18) ... Named the team's MVP for three consecutive years ... Received multiple All-State, All-Region, and All-Valley honors ... Named to the All-State Academic Team ... Also competed in basketball and track for SHS. Personal: Parents are Rick and Jeannine Henage... Has five older brothers (Thomas, Daniel, Michael, Matthew, and Jonathan) and one younger sister (Alisha) ... Plans to study dental hygiene.
